About the Role
Standard Bots is developing a robotics, vision, and networking platform to lower the barrier to entry for real-world automation. The control systems and embedded engineering team builds the foundational technologies that empower the company and entire industries. This role is critical in ensuring control quality across robotic products through modern engineering practices, operating at the hardware-software boundary.
Responsibilities
- Own control performance across products, including smooth motion, tracking accuracy, and high-fidelity impedance control.
- Design and own control-loop benchmarking and validation across communication architectures like CAN and EtherCAT.
- Analytically model in-house actuator plants, verify models through physical testing, and determine appropriate plant tolerance bands.
- Implement and document safety-rated monitoring and stop functions to certification rigor.
- Ensure maximal servo performance while maintaining stability and rejecting disturbances under various dynamic loading conditions.
- Debug complex system-level issues spanning software, firmware, electrical, or component behavior.
- Build test and diagnostic tooling for tuning, hardware characterization, and fault injection.
- Act as a technical bridge between hardware and software, advising leadership on technical strategy and mentoring engineers.
Requirements
- 5+ years of proven experience modelling control systems.
- 5+ years of proven experience tuning control loops on real-world systems.
- 5+ years of proven experience validating models through physical experiments on benchtop equipment.
- Strong classical controls fundamentals, including analytical and heuristic tuning, plant and controller modelling, gain and phase margin analysis, and bandwidth modelling and testing.
- Real-time signal processing and filtering expertise.
- Sufficient understanding of firmware, electrical, and mechanical systems to resolve issues at their intersections.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- A proactive approach to prioritizing simplicity, reliability, and velocity.
- Experience with modern control techniques like MPC (nice to have).
- Experience with sensors, especially encoders, and sensor fusion (nice to have).
- Experience interfacing with robotic motion planning systems (nice to have).
- Electrical and board-level experience, including comfort with o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, and DMMs (nice to have).
